4. S. mollissima (L.) Pers. View in CoL , Syn. Pl. 1: 498 (1805).

Calyx 20- 22 mm, densely tomentose, eglandular. Petals whitish, with ciliate claw and small coronal scales. Capsule 10-12 mm, as long as carpophore. • Islas Baléares (Ibiza); Gibraltar. BI Hs.
